Moreover, forming or joining a trading mastermind group can be highly beneficial. A mastermind group is a small, select group of individuals with similar goals and interests who meet regularly to exchange knowledge, provide support, and hold each other accountable. In the context of stock trading, a mastermind group can offer a safe environment to openly discuss trading strategies, share experiences, and challenge each other’s assumptions. This collaborative approach can spark new ideas, help identify blind spots, and provide inspiration and motivation to reach new heights in your trading endeavors.
